Diving Deep into Features
The Garmin Fenix 8 Solar isn't just about looks and solar charging; it's also packed to the brim with advanced features that cater to a wide range of activities and interests. Whether you're a serious athlete, an outdoor adventurer, or just someone who wants to stay connected and informed, this watch has you covered. Let's start with the fitness tracking capabilities. The Fenix 8 Solar offers a comprehensive suite of metrics, including heart rate monitoring, GPS tracking, activity tracking, and sleep analysis. It can track a vast array of activities, from running and cycling to swimming and skiing, providing detailed insights into your performance and progress. The built-in GPS is incredibly accurate, ensuring precise tracking of your routes and distances. The heart rate monitor is equally reliable, providing real-time data to help you optimize your workouts. The watch also offers advanced training features, such as training load, training status, and recovery time recommendations, which can help you tailor your workouts to achieve your fitness goals. Beyond fitness, the Fenix 8 Solar excels in its outdoor navigation capabilities. It comes preloaded with topographic maps and offers advanced navigation tools, such as route planning, turn-by-turn directions, and backtracking, making it an invaluable companion for hiking, camping, and other outdoor adventures. The watch also includes a barometric altimeter, a compass, and a thermometer, providing essential environmental data. In terms of smart features, the Fenix 8 Solar keeps you connected with notifications for calls, texts, and emails. It also supports Garmin Pay, allowing you to make contactless payments directly from your wrist. The watch has a built-in music player, so you can listen to your favorite tunes without needing your phone. The Fenix 8 Solar is a true all-in-one device, seamlessly blending fitness, outdoor, and smart features into a single, powerful package.
